Between 2017 and 2024, the City of Paris paid €264k to Instituto Cervantes in 8 grants, mainly in international.

Source: opendata.paris.fr (grants paid, annex to the administrative account), data as of 13 September 2026.

Cultural institution of the Spanish government (8th, 7 rue Quentin Bauchart, Champs-Élysées) created in 1991: Spanish teaching and dissemination of Hispanic cultures. 100,000+ students/year. 2005 Prince of Asturias Prize.
